Glossary
AssimilativeAttending to information – reading, watching, listening. |
Bus-stop methodTerm used in teaching to refer to long division. |
Digital StorytellingIt enables computer users to become creative storytellers through the traditional processes of selecting a topic, conducting some research, writing a script, and developing an interesting story. |
Problem DistillerClassification table which helps you to identify why students have specific problems in Tricky Topics. |
Problem ExampleExamples of the problems students have which display their misunderstanding of the Tricky Topic and are symptoms of one or more Stumbling Blocks in that Tricky Topic. |
Stumbling BlockIdentifiable and assessable component parts of a Tricky Topic which are common to a variety of students’ problems. |
TaxonomyThe practice of classification. |
threshold conceptConcepts that transform a students' understanding of a subject, without which it is impossible to progress in that subject. Sometimes counter-intuitive and difficult to grasp. |
Tricky TopicTopics containing difficult concepts that students find difficult to learn and teachers find difficult to teach. |
